Start by gathering the necessary information: You will need the values for pressure, volume, temperature, and the gas constant.
02
Identify the units for each of these variables and make sure they are consistent.
03
Use the ideal gas law formula: PV = nRT, where P is the pressure, V is the volume, n is the number of moles of gas, R is the gas constant, and T is the temperature.
04
Determine the values for each variable and substitute them into the formula.
05
Solve for the unknown variable by rearranging the formula as needed, using appropriate algebraic manipulations.
06
Calculate the value of the unknown variable and ensure it has the correct units.
07
Double-check your calculations and ensure they are accurate.
